Arthritis is a general term for more than 100 conditions that cause joint pain and dysfunction. Other symptoms include redness, swelling, and stiffness in the involved joints. Arthritis can affect individual joints or joints throughout your body, including your knees, wrists, shoulders, spine, and feet.

Arthritis has different types that are categorized based on the cause of your symptoms. Arthritis types include:

  • Degenerative (aka Osteoarthritis): Result of wear and tear.
  • Inflammatory: Caused by high levels of inflammation.
  • Infectious: Occurs when a joint becomes infected.
  • Metabolic: Result of metabolic deposits in the joints.
